Hanoi (VNA) –Vietnam has 620 industrial aquatic processing facilities, according to theDirectorate of Fisheries at the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development.

Of them, 415 have metstandards for exports to Japan, the US, Europe and other markets.

In addition, there aresome 3,000 small-scale establishments at traditional trade villages.

Aqua productprocessing has become a spearhead sector which boasts a large production volumeand takes the lead in international integration, said the Directorate.

Vietnamese aquaproducts have made their appearance in 176 markets across the globe.

Furthermore, localprocessors are striving to boost domestic production and consumption as exportsare hindered by the COVID-19 pandemic.

Vietnam earned 790million USD from exporting aquatic products in May, lifting the total figure inthe first five months of this year to nearly 3.3 billion USD, a year-on-yearrise of 14 percent./.

🧜 Maximum fine of 3,000 USD proposed for violating invoice regulations

Under a draft to amend and supplement the Government's Decree 125/2020/ND-CP on administrative sanctions for violations of tax and invoice regulations, the Ministry of Finance has proposed classifying the failure to issue invoices into five different levels. Infraction levels will correspond to fines of 1 million VND to 80 million VND, depending on the nature and number of invoicing violations.

🍃 Banks accelerate digitalisation, non-cash payments

Cashless payments are growing at an impressive rate, averaging 30–40% annually. Vietnam’s per capita cashless transaction volume now trails only China, with total value of 295.2 quadrillion VND (11.26 trillion USD), or 26 times of its GDP.
